Thank you very much for sharing this feedback with us!
The Buy Button can create duplicate carts by default if installed on your Shopify store instead of an external store, which may be what you've seen here. This is due to the fact the the Buy Button is designed for external websites and therefore creates its own independent cart on a website.

***CHECK YOUR BUY BUTTONS, THIS DOES NOT WORK FOR IPHONE & IPAD USERS***
I just discovered after months of use that any Buy Button embedded code on my website does not work while the website is viewed on iPhone or iPad in Safari and Chrome. When clicked, a white screen displays that requires you to force close the browser. I am absolutely SICK to my stomach at the thought of how much money this has cost us.
This was tough to discover as it works fine on desktop and Android.
